Social workers vs Teaching assistants: which pays more in the UK?

Data from ONS ASHE · 2026

Salary comparison

MetricSocial workersTeaching assistants
Median (50th pct)£42,708£18,024
Mean£41,623£17,504
25th percentile£35,841£13,660
75th percentile£48,907£21,468

Bottom line

Social workers typically earns around 137% more than Teaching assistants in the UK (£42,708 vs £18,024 median).
